About the role:

Are you passionate about making a real difference in children’s lives? We’re on the hunt for an amazing Special Educational Needs Teaching Assistant to join our friendly school family in Nottingham. If you love working with kids and have a knack for helping those who need a little extra support, we want to hear from you!

 What You’ll Be Doing:

  • Being that crucial support person for our amazing SEN students
  • Getting creative with teachers to make learning accessible and fun
  • Keeping track of how our students are doing (nothing too fancy, just good notes!)
  • Running small group sessions where the magic happens
  • Being there for students when they need emotional or behavioural support
  • Joining in with our planning sessions (we love fresh ideas!)
